How this figure is calculated
Emission Totals - Indirect emissions (N2O) - Manure applied to Soils divided by Population, total, matched on country and year. Neither publisher issues this ratio as a series; it is computed here from both.
Emission Totals - Indirect emissions (N2O) - Manure applied to Soils ÷ Population, total
Computed from
- Emission Totals - Indirect emissions (N2O) - Manure applied to Soils FAO, FAOSTAT Climate Change, Emissions Totals, http://www.fao.org/faostat/en/#data/GT
- Population, total World Population Prospects, United Nations (UN)
Statizoid computes this series; the underlying measurements belong to the publishers named above. The arithmetic is applied to every country and year where both inputs report, and nothing is estimated unless the page says so.
